Peter Howitt

Recently added

Dangerous Parking
0

Dangerous Parking

Jun. 01, 2007

Dangerous Parking

Noah Arkwright, a successful, hard living and indulgent independent British film director, finally decides to try and defeat the many addictions ...
Defying Gravity
0

Defying Gravity

Aug. 02, 2009

Defying Gravity

In the very near future, a team of eight astronauts embarking on a six-year journey to explore Venus and other planets in the solar system, find ...